WebSep 8, 2024 · Extract of a birth certificate. The extract of the birth certificate contains the following information: your last name; your first name(s); your place of birth; your date of birth. Details regarding your parents are not included in the extract. Multilingual …

WebA birth certificate provides written proof that your birth is recorded in the Registry of Births, Deaths and Marriages. You can request a copy of the certificate in Dutch or as a multiple-language (international) extract. You request this in the municipality where you were born.
